抗缪勒管激素的临床应用

Clinical Application of Anti-Müllerian Hormone

  • 摘要: 抗缪勒管激素(anti-Müllerian hormone, AMH)是由女性卵泡颗粒细胞和男性睾丸支持细胞分泌的二聚体糖蛋白, 可抑制女性卵泡的募集和生长, 调节男性睾丸间质细胞的功能。目前文章多阐述其临床应用:检测血清AMH的水平可用于评估卵巢储备, 预测辅助生殖过程中的卵巢反应, 评估肿瘤患者卵巢储备, 辅助诊断多囊卵巢综合征、卵巢早衰及预测绝经等, 但对其检测方法和参考区间研究阐述较少。近年来, 随着AMH检测技术的发展, 临床应用领域越来越广泛, 本文就AMH的生理、临床应用、检测方法和参考区间等问题进行深入探讨。

     

    Abstract: Anti-Müllerian hormone(AMH) is a dimeric glycoprotein secreted by follicular granulosa cell and sertoli cell. AMH inhibits the recruitment and growth of follicles in female, and adjusts the function of leydig cells in male. Serum AMH level is a potential marker for ovarian reserve. At present, the article elaborated its clinical application:the level of serum AMH can be used to evaluate ovarian reserve, to predict ovarian response during assisted reproductive process, to evaluate ovarian reserve of cancer patients, to diagnose polycystic ovary syndrome, premature ovarian failure and predictive menopause. There are few studies on the detection methods and reference intervals. With the development of detection technology, AMH has become more widely used in clinical medicine. The physiology, clinical application, assay methods and reference intervals of AMH are discussed in this article.
